I'd be amazed if an electric handbrake is even possible to retro fit. Never mind the hardware side of it such as the electric operated calipers or puller for drums, it's the wiring and software to integrate it properly into the abs and esp systems. Honestly I'd be telling them you want a manual handbrake or no deal. The electric systems can be troublesome and are a pain if you want to tow it or move it without starting the engine.
